My name is ahmed from somalia live germany for the last 9 months got rejected two times bamf and court. Got duldung appointment from auslandehorde because they told me I had document in italia so I can't live here any longer . So is there any way I can remain in germany also how long my duldung will be. Thanks

I am not sure if I fully understand your case. If you have a dublin case, the authorities have only limited time to take you back to Italy. If they don't make it within this period, germany becomes responsible for your asylum case.

If you have a residence permission in Italy (you mentioned you have "documents" from italy), there is no such deadline for the authorities.

In both cases, I would expect the Duldung to be issued only for a short time (like 3 months, but I don't know for sure).
